Rep Power: 400 1. Tuner lugnuts have thin shanks so you can get a key over them or in them to get them on and off. The wheels are designed so the lugnuts fit tightly into the countersinks drilled for them, rather than providing a lot of room around them to get a regular nut and socket on to.
2. Stock lugnuts have a ball nose. Almost all aftermarket wheels have conical tapers... which means you need to use a cone-ended lugnut. Using a ball lugnut in a conical hole WILL ruin the wheel.
I think that should suffice as reason enough.
